Big Sales Abound in Sherman this Memorial Day Weekend!

        Make nearby Sherman, CT, one of your destinations this Memorial Day weekend!

        Saturday kicks off THREE BIG SALES. All run Saturday: 9 am to 4 pm and Sunday: 9 am to 12 pm, so make time for each.

        BARN SALE: The 30th annual, fundraising Barn Sale at the Sherman Historical Society. Come early for the awesome bargains, fantastic finds, and wonderful quality items (including estate donations such as original oil paintings, two matching horse hair chairs, two matching mahogany tilt-top tables, curio cabinet, antique brass bird cage, caned high chair and more!). Stay (or come back) for lunchtime hot dogs and beverages. The Old Store gift shop, which always has wonderful items in stock, will be open as well. The Historical Society is located at 10 Route 37 Center, with convenient parking nearby.

        BOOK SALE: While you’re in the Center, check out the Sherman Library Book Sale. There will be thousands of books, organized for easy browsing, plus rare books, audio books and DVDs. The Library is at 1 Sherman Center.

        TAG SALE: Just a hop/skip from the Center, is the Jewish Community Center Tag Sale, which always features a wonderful array of treasures!The JCC is located just beyond town at 9 Route 39 South.

        All of the monies raised from the above events goes to support these worthy non-profit organizations, their buildings, and their many wonderful programs for- and services to- the community.

        All these sales must close promptly at noon because Sherman Center closes to traffic shortly afterward for the 50th Annual Memorial Day Parade at 1pm. Our theme this year will be WWI and Suffragists.
